Born in the San Gabriel Valley, Isabel Fulmer grew up in a home shaped by service, kindness, and purpose. With a mother who is a special education teacher and a father in law enforcement, she learned early the meaning of compassion, responsibility, and standing up for others. Their example became the foundation of the leader she is becoming. Growing up in Title I schools, Isabel saw how many students feel like big opportunities are for “other kids.” She once felt that way too—until she realized she could use her creativity and voice to help change that belief for thousands of children. As the author of the bilingual children’s book My Abuela’s Castle, Isabel brings her message of hope into classrooms across Los Angeles. She reads to students and leads her signature “Build Your Empire Mindset” workshop, where each child chooses a power word—such as Dream, Brave, or Possible—and writes it on a brick to build a colorful wall of possibility. For many students, it’s the first time someone has told them that their future is worth building. Isabel is deeply committed to community service. Through the National Charity League, Foothill Chapter, she and her mother serve side by side, strengthening their bond through philanthropy and giving back to organizations across the region. This mother–daughter tradition has shaped Isabel’s heart for service and her belief that kindness is action. This year, Isabel served as an open-title Teen USA delegate, and through that opportunity earned a four-year scholarship to Mississippi State University—a milestone that showed young girls watching her that their dreams are within reach, no matter where they come from. She is also a State Ambassador for Best Buddies, championing friendship and inclusion for individuals with intellectual and developmental disabilities. Through her partnership with CARE Los Angeles, she teaches financial literacy and confidence to students throughout the L.A. area—all while balancing honors and AP coursework, varsity cheer, and water polo. Her chosen charity is Compassion International, a reflection of her heart for service and her belief that uplifting others is the foundation of every meaningful life. Isabel hopes to be remembered not for crowns or titles, but for the impact she leaves on others—the students who discover their power, the young people who see themselves in her story, and the belief she inspires that every dream is possible.
